"R.E.A.C.H." Clinical Portal Making a Difference in Doctors' and Patients’ Lives

R.E.A.C.H. or "Rapid Electronic Access to Clinical Health Information"is an electronic health information portal that allows authorized users access to their patients’ clinical information through a secure web-browser, whether inside or outside of the hospital.

This means Lab and Diagnostic test results, images, transcriptions and progress reports written (at any one of the REACH partner Hospital's) can be viewed immediately by a Physician treating the patient. Currently the REACH portal includes The Credit Valley Hospital William Osler Health Centre, and Halton Health Care. Trillium Health Centre and Headwaters Health Care Centre will be joining the network soon and Hamilton Health Sciences and the Scarborough Hospital also use the same vendor solution. Sharing Patient's clinical information is important because patients move between facilities for across a region to access different types of diagnostic tests and/or procedures---that are not necessarily performed at all facilities. Dr. Tom McGowan’s Notes*: Wednesday October 15, 2008
Sitting in clinic today it struck me how quickly REACH has changed how I work. Today was a day when I saw new cancer patients with new problems. Of the four new patients I saw today, I needed to look into REACH to get information from other hospitals on two of them. It took seconds to look them up, and find the information I needed from the other hospitals. Before REACH, getting that information would have taken anywhere from 15 minutes to hours, and usually many phone calls.

Given that we’re the only Radiation program in the region, we always see patients who have had all, or large portions, of their care elsewhere. Most of the time the referring doctors make sure all the information is faxed over when the referral is made. Most of the time we can make the decisions we need to make with the information we have. But if there was a recent test, or clinic visit, then we should see that report before we make a final treatment recommendation.

There’s wasted time and effort when information comes in piecemeal. There are times when the results of the test aren’t available when the patient is first referred by their medical doctor (MD). Sometimes the referring MD will send it when it’s ready, and sometimes not. We can’t expect that to happen because it’s too much to ask a busy referring doctor to keep track of upcoming tests, and make sure they’re faxed to us, when ready.

Even if it is sent after the result is in, we’ve got to be sure the new information gets attached to the original. While this normally happens, I’ve had cases where I’ve had our staff call a referring hospital to get a test result faxed over. Sometimes they say they’ve already sent it but we don’t have it. So we get them to send it again, only to find it went to my office rather than my clinic.

When there appear to be duplicates of the same test, there’s more time wasted while I compare the results from the two documents. Only then can I be sure it’s not new information that will influence the patient’s care. It’s pretty obvious that this isn’t the most efficient way to manage anybody’s time. Now I have an advantage that I hadn’t really appreciated until I started to use the REACH portal. By looking at the records from other hospitals, we can sometimes see results of tests that are relevant, but that the patient didn’t realize could be useful, or had completely forgotten about. This type of thing doesn’t happen very often, but when it does, it matters.

So getting back to today; I had two patients that had information I needed from other hospitals. Thanks to REACH, I had it, easily after looking for a few seconds. I didn’t have to figure out what to ask for, where things might have been done, and deciding whether I really needed it in the first place. I was able to spend all my clinic time doing clinical work, seeing my patients, explaining things to them, and figuring out what they needed to do next. And that makes for a satisfying day.

REACHing for Leading-Edge Patient Care with e-Health



By Dan Germain, VP, CFO and CIO at the Credit Valley Hospital and former e-Health lead for the Mississauga Halton Local Health Integration Network (LHIN.)

In Ontario, very few hospitals can share their disparate Electronic Health Records (EHRs) between providers or with patients/clients. To facilitate sharing of patients’ EHRs among physicians and clinicians, The Credit Valley Hospital (CVH) joined William Osler Health Centre (WOHC) and Halton Healthcare Services (HHS) to establish an electronic clinical portal. Trillium Health Centre (THC) and Headwaters Health Care Centre (HHCC) have also entered into this partnership and will go live in the next few months extending the Rapid Electronic Access to Clinical Health (REACH) EHR initiative to all hospitals within two LHINs serving a catchment area of 1.8 million Ontario residents (about 5% of the total Canadian population). This existing collaboration between six physical hospital sites in the Peel and Halton regions and two LHINs – the Mississauga Halton LHIN (MH LHIN) and the Central West LHIN (CW LHIN) – is unprecedented and a landmark partnership in the Province of Ontario.

The REACH Clinical (EHR) Portal enables all associated sites’ clinicians to have instant access to longitudinal patient health information including but not limited to allergies and alerts, lab and diagnostic test results, diagnostic images and reports, pharmacy data, transcribed notes, scanned images, progress reports, and other important health-related information. A thorough Privacy Impact Assessment was also perforemed to ensure REACH meets all Ontario privacy standards.

At each constituent hospital, patient data is easily accessed today through our secure network solution and consolidated into one customizable, patient-centric view. Based on a federated data-model, patient data remains in its original format on its respective (legacy) vendor IT system, allowing for all systems to be leveraged across multiple domains, rather than replacing them. Additionally, using a federated data-model ensured implementation of the REACH clinical portal was extremely fast and inexpensive especially when compared to other more complex solutions. The partnership between REACH Hospital stakeholders not only enhances patient safety and satisfaction, it provides an intuitive web-based interface that is accessible anywhere.

The REACH portal was created using MEDSEEK in partnership with Agfa HealthCare, both leading providers of enterprise-wide e-Health solutions. This simple portal solution is also vendor-agnostic, so the system is compatible with almost all health information systems, diagnostic imaging vendors, and other suppliers. “Over 160 interfaces are available on a plug-and-play like basis,” says Dan Germain, Vice President, Chief Financial Officer and Chief Information Officer at CVH.

Dr. Paul Philbrook, CVH’s Chief of Family Medicine and Chair of the Central West – Mississauga Halton Community Family Medicine/Public Health Network of Physicians, along with his colleagues, championed the idea of allowing affiliated physicians the opportunity to access their patient records across all local hospital sites. He explains, “The REACH portal is a welcome advancement of access to patient information and integration locally. This will enhance patient care and safety.”

Germain, also former e-Health lead for the Mississauga-Halton LHIN, further explains, “The REACH portal was created for physicians and clinicians to improve patient care and provide real-time access to existing patient records across the region. Although more time is needed to determine the quantifiable benefits of such a solution, it is expected that the REACH Portal will assist in avoiding potential medical errors and offset the possibility that other critical information is inadvertently missed for elective, emergency admissions or outpatient visits. Saving just one life by using this system will pay for itself.”

To date, the REACH EHR portal is getting over 9,000 views per month within the Mississauga-Halton and Central West LHINs---with one-third of those views made by Physicians looking at patient data from other hospitals. Over 1,000,000 outpatient visits and 100,000 discharges per year are now available within the REACH portal at this time. “The clinicians who are accessing patient information via the REACH portal love it,” says Germain. The portal has the ability to consolidate information about a patient/client from other sources (e.g., Community Care Access Centre’s), but currently, the focus is to bring more hospitals on stream and ensure as much clinical data is contained in the portal as needed.

The Mississauga-Halton and Central West LHIN's are fortunate in securing both the commitment of all regional hospitals to join the REACH portal, and also engaging a vendor solution that was both comprehensive and transferrable outside the walls of any specific site. This collaboration between regional hospitals is a stepping stone toward the overall e-Health goals for the province of Ontario, for example, building a standardized methodology to identify each unique patient and then consolidate electronic health care data from a variety of sources (e.g. hospitals, private laboratories, pharmacies, nursing homes.) Rebooting Canadian Healthcare using eHealth Portals

by Dan Germain, VP, Chief Financial and Information Officer, The Credit Valley Hospital as published in Canadian Healthcare Technology Magazine | Vol.12, No. 8 | Nov/Dec 2007.

According to recent statistics from the Canadian Institute for Health Information, as many as 24,000 Canadians die each year from adverse events like surgical errors, patients receiving the wrong medication, and hospital-acquired infections. As the practice of medicine today is inherently dependent upon healthcare technology, the accountability and sustainability of our healthcare system depends on the ability of healthcare practitioners to find ways of gaining efficiencies and increasing effectiveness in every aspect of their daily activities.

All levels of government across Canada are experiencing pressures today to cut healthcare delivery costs, while increasing the level patient safety and care. With this demand for managed care, technology is quickly evolving to meet new and more complex requirements, with significant benefits to medicine and healthcare overall. As Charles Darwin so aptly identified: “It is not the strongest of the species that survive, nor the most intelligent, but the one most responsive to change.” In the past, the acquisition of technology was viewed as the answer in and of itself. Decisions about technology and usage were typically driven by the question of how to improve the effectiveness of what hospitals were already doing. However, today’s information systems should be viewed as a vehicle to transform current hospital processes into what they could and should be doing.

At the same time, there is a demonstrated understanding for the need to update technology systems in order to extend a national electronic health record (EHR) in Canada. Healthcare stakeholders agree that technology is critical to facilitating necessary information-sharing across disciplines and venues. Driven by Canadian Health Infoway, this movement embraces the need to evolve healthcare informatics toward a more open, standards-based, patient-centric model that brings together all imperatives: clinical, administrative, financial, managerial, and human resources.

With the information-sharing capabilities provided today by a rapidly expanding number of new technologies, Canadian healthcare organizations can leverage a crucial tool-set to support informed medical decisions at the point of care. To this end, healthcare providers and vendors both agree that a consistent, standardized way to share information between healthcare stakeholders can overcome the barriers to attaining an EHR.

One destination; Many paths
When any healthcare organization sets out to extend a ‘cradle-to-the-grave’ EHR – readily accessible via the Internet and linked to clinical protocols and guidelines — most people picture only one scenario. In this scenario, a user enters a patient query into one computer system, and that query goes to one source where all the patient information has been stored in a single “centralized” database, or vertical architecture. The system searches one database and returns the queried information to the user. The problem with this scenario, is that information is not best accessed in this manner as the required patient data resides somewhere in a disparate system.

However, this is not the only option. Instead of duplicating that patient data in a new centralized system, the healthcare organization could leave the existing data in place. Then, when the user enters a query about a patient, the system logically gathers the appropriate patient data from wherever it is stored. This approach is called a “federated” database model and employs a horizontal architecture. Anyone who uses the Internet takes the delivery of content from multiple systems for granted. Almost every Web page is automatically assembled from multiple sources, and employs a federated database model. One simply clicks a button and data is retrieved from disparate databases and servers.

By definition, a federated database is a collection of data stored on multiple autonomous computing systems connected by a network that is intuitively presented to users as one integrated database. Additionally, using a federated portal approach allows bandwidth, hardware, administration, and other infrastructure costs to be distributed over time, keeping pace with the development and deployment of the facility. This can significantly reduce networking and system-interfacing costs and opens up a number of added functional possibilities by extending data to the organization’s value chain delivering clear, tangible benefits for your short and long term needs. Compared to a centralized portal, today’s federated architecture can achieve equivalent or better results, at a fraction of the cost and time.

Patient Destiny: Consumers must have access to their health records

By Kevin J. Leonard and David Wiljer

Just as customers accessing their information have reduced banking industry costs, it is a general assumption that the same will hold true in healthcare. As more patients bypass the “hands-on” personal method and obtain information for themselves, it is estimated that great savings will be gained, and consequently, a tremendous amount of strain will be removed from the system.

However, very seldom is patient information (e.g., the specific results of diagnostic tests) ever shared with the patient. As a result, it is very difficult for patients to enter a dialogue with their doctors about treatment, because the healthcare provider is the only one with the information. One truism seems to be constantly ignored: It is impossible for patients to manage their health without the requisite information! This is not just a passing fad or part of a catchy slogan, but rather a conclusion that is based on a number of logical premises, outlined as follows:

Times have changed: This may not appear to be all that insightful, at first glance, but this premise contains very important building blocks. We are no longer in an era where businesses and governments tell people what to do and when. The rise in consumerism has created the demand from the public for better information and better service. The public wants information in the way they want it, when they want it. We have rapidly progressed through the Information Age into a “Knowledge Era”. Information that is meaningless to consumers has no value. In the next 20 years, the industries that will be successful will be the ones that can take advantage of technology and deliver pertinent information, which is “targeted knowledge” channeled down to the individual consumer.

Patients are at the centre of healthcare: We have seen many Hospital Mission statements echoing this same message – changing to patient-centered care. However, this ‘mantra’ has not been firmly understood or appreciated. Without the patient, there is no need for healthcare professionals. The patient is the one constant throughout all of the healthcare system.

What patients do want, and will demand, is better information about the system, about who does what services, and about how well they perform these services. Answers to these questions will allow consumers to make informed decisions surrounding their care.

Patients want access to their own patient information – and they want to be able to understand what it is that they are reading. In particular, they want to know more about their illness or disease, and they want information on treatment options and success rates. Often, they would like to get in touch with other patients to exchange experiences and to get advice. After all, it is only when they interact with other patients that they get real information about what they are going, or will go, through.

Ultimately, patients are the decision makers: When patients are faced with difficult healthcare questions, they seek advice – from their doctors, other health professionals, and their own personal network. Even though the physician will provide the best medical support, ultimately, it is the patient who has to decide whether they want this drug treatment or that surgery.

It is understood that not all patients may have the maturity or cognitive ability to comprehend the decisions that they have to make. Many caregivers have used this argument to withhold information; but, in actuality, this rebuttal only applies to a small percentage – perhaps, to 20 percent of our population. The remaining 80 percent have the ability and the right to make their own decisions. What they lack is the medical background in order to facilitate all the information and to process it in order to make an informed choice.

It is our belief that in the healthcare system of the future, we will see physicians (and other professionals) act as advisors to patients, rather than the old model, where patients are told what to do. Gone will be the day where patients will feel that they are not free to question facts or to seek options.

Decision-makers need information: It is well understood in information theory, and in the decision analysis literature, that decision-makers need information to assist in making any decision. It then becomes clear that we must get the critical information to the patient in order for them to make informed decisions. This means that the focal point of the healthcare system of the future must be on the patient record, since that is the only point where all the data reside. In order to move the data and information around efficiently, it is obvious as well that this record will have to be in an electronic form.

Conclusion: Patients must be able to access their health records and other patient information if they are to make informed and effective decisions about their health management. Consequently, it is impossible for patients to manage their health without this requisite information!
Access to records improves satisfaction for lung transplant patients
Over 40 percent of patients have at least one chronic illness, accounting for nearly two thirds of all medical expenditures. Because of their long timeframe and high attendant costs over time, chronic illnesses lend themselves to electronically mediated self-management tools. Prototypes of web-based, patient-centered Information and Decision Support Tools have been demonstrated to improve self-management of illness and enhance understanding of the complications of poorly controlled disease. Patients living with chronic illness are also more likely to use health information than their healthier counterparts, although each chronic illness has specific, recognizable challenges for affected patients in symptom comprehension, information management, task fulfillment and social interaction.

It is our hypothesis that leadership will come from these chronically ill patients (either individually or within a group) by demanding better access to health system and service information. In recent research, we interviewed patients on a number of “access to information” issues. Unfortunately, asking patients (or computer end-users or stakeholders) what information they would like to receive is not efficacious due to the fact that end-users are normally not well versed in “system options”.

What stakeholders are very good at, however, is identifying functionality they would “like to have” at the moment that they experience it. As a result, we have engaged different groups of patients suffering from a chronic condition. In this instance, we present results on post-lung transplant patients in both passive (survey interview) and active (simulation) environments to elicit their needs and wants. (This group was analyzed due to accessibility, however, it is believed that many of the findings are applicable across a number of illnesses or chronic conditions.)

Almost two-thirds of these lung transplant patients (63 percent) had seen some portion of their medical record (most commonly blood work or X-ray results) and a similar percentage believed a personal medical record would help them manage their personal healthcare. The most common reason respondents wanted access to their medical chart was to enhance their understanding of their medical condition. This desire to have further access to personal medical information was expressed despite a comprehensive patient education program provided by the transplant program, and despite the fact a high degree of patients felt they were provided with an adequate degree of information upon discharge from hospital. As a whole, this group appears to have a high level of interest in their medical information and can be described as active participants in their care.

The patients were then asked what they believe would be the most valuable aspect of having access to their medical information. Respondents were encouraged to check all that apply:

• 57 percent of patients believe that access to their medical information would help enhance their understanding of their medical condition.

• 13 percent of patients indicated that access to their medical information would help ensure the information was available to their family doctor.

• 13 percent of patients felt access to this information was important in case of an emergency.

Further, over 60 percent of patients believe that having access to information about the medical care that they receive would help in managing their healthcare while at home. The difference in the phrasing of each question may illustrate the importance patients’ place on information necessary for self-management over information about their hospital stay. Sixty percent of patients believe that if they were provided with their medical record, they themselves and their family physician would use it the most. Related to the use of the patient’s medical record, 73 percent of respondents did not have any concerns about a family physician, family members or other medical specialists having access to their record.

Patients were also given the chance to choose what type of information from the hospital they would find useful to help manage their care at home The most popular choice was the lab test and results (67 percent) followed by a summary of their medical history, medication information (history and current), contact information (specialists and emergency contacts) and blood pressure/ temperature charts. Family and personal history and height/weight charts were not strongly endorsed. Only 17 percent of all respondents felt the inclusion of an allergy history was necessary in their personal health record. Given a choice, 63 percent of patients would want this information as a paper copy. Other preferences included CD (13 percent), secure Internet (13 percent), and other storage device (10 percent). Forty-seven percent of respondents indicated that they would find it useful to have the entire lung transplant manual in an electronic format.

The survey indicates that lung transplant patients are interested in accessing their personal health information to support their health management. At the time of the survey, well over half of the sample group was connected to the Internet and according to the literature, it can be expected they are accessing health information through that medium. This desire stems from increased self-reliance in the management of personal health and the desire to take a more active role in the medical decision-making process. While the effect that this information may have on patient health outcomes is not clear, access to personal health information is associated with improved patient satisfaction. As patients move to a more self-reliant role in the management of their health, the demand for personalized information will only increase.

Conclusions: We must begin to put pressure on the system to support patients in gaining access to their own health information. As presented herein, this is needed and soon will be demanded. Ultimately, this inevitability has been framed by the term Patient Destiny, where patients are actively involved in all healthcare decision-making. This is an infeasible proposition in a paper-based system, which means we must move to more Electronic Health Records or EHRs.
